YSU and Murdoch University Dubai outline prospects for international cooperation
Today, YSU Rector Hovhannes Hovhannisyan hosted Mohammed Bamatraf, Executive Director of Murdoch University Dubai, to discuss avenues for cooperation between the two institutions and to identify areas of mutual interest.

Murdoch University Dubai is a branch campus of Murdoch University in Australia—one of the country’s leading research institutions. The university has more than 23,000 students and over 2,500 employees from nearly 100 countries worldwide. Its Dubai campus was established in 2008.
During the meeting, YSU Rector Hovhannes Hovhannisyan presented an overview of YSU’s core areas of activity, educational and research programs, student opportunities, and initiatives aimed at the university’s development.
Mohammed Bamatraf, in turn, introduced Murdoch University Dubai, emphasizing that the institution is accredited by two prominent bodies: the Commission for Academic Accreditation (CAA) and the Knowledge and Human Development Authority (KHDA).
The two sides discussed various formats for collaboration in fields of mutual interest, including academic mobility, joint research projects, and cultural exchanges.
The meeting was also attended by YSU Vice-Rector for Academic Affairs Elina Asriyan, Vice-Rector for Development and Innovation Mikayel Hovhannisyan, and Head of the International Cooperation Office Alexander Markarov.
